The brisk pace of the opening paragraph affect this story because;

  • A.) It captures the excitement and happiness Ezra feels about getting his driver’s license.

At the beginning of this passage, the writer used short sentences that had a tone of excitement to capture the happiness that Ezra feels because of obtaining his driver's license.

When a person is excited, it is often captured in the excitement of the tone of their voice and the hurried manner they speak. Their words also have a brisk pace.

All of these characteristics are seen at the beginning of this passage and they accurately capture Ezra's excitement.
